Does anyone know where I can buy another power cable for my new iBook?
No, I don't mean a Power Adapter, I mean just the cable that plugs into the yo-yo. I don't need another whole adaptor, just another cable.
Any ideas?

Does anyone know where I can buy another power cable for my new iBook?
No, I don't mean a Power Adapter, I mean just the cable that plugs into the yo-yo. I don't need another whole adaptor, just another cable.
You can get it at PBParts.com. The link to the cable is:
PBParts.com Product Listing
The part number is M7332 and the cost is $14.00 (ouch).
